Using matlab greatly simplifies the number crunching associated with problems in systems, control, and signal processing. Name is the argument name and value is the corresponding value. Numerical integration matlab integral mathworks france. A key difficulty in the design of good algorithms for this problem is that formulas for the variance may involve sums of squares, which can lead to numerical instability as well as to arithmetic overflow when dealing with large values. Simple calculator in matlab download free open source. I have an histogram with data which i think it is not normal and i want to draw the normal density probability function over my histogram but the function i know histfit uses normal data. Average or mean value of array matlab mean mathworks. Vamos a establecer una binomial con 5 pruebas y probabilidad 0. Note that the distributionspecific function chi2pdf is faster than the generic function pdf. You can specify several name and value pair arguments in any order as name1,value1.
Using analysis of covariance, you can model y as a linear function of x, with the coefficients of the line possibly varying from group to group.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. Algorithms for calculating variance play a major role in computational statistics. This example shows how to use matlab functions to calculate the maximum, mean, and standard deviation values for a 24by3 matrix called count. V var a returns the variance of the elements of a along the first array dimension whose size does not equal 1. Simplify the network through deltay transform and calculate the equivalent resistance by 2b method. Binomial coefficient or all combinations matlab nchoosek. This matlab function returns the variance of the elements of a along the first. Other javascript in this series are categorized under different areas of applications in the menu section on this page. Tall arrays calculate with arrays that have more rows. Random numbers from normal distribution with specific mean and.
If a is a vector of observations, c is the scalarvalued variance if a is a matrix whose columns represent random variables and whose rows represent observations, c is the covariance matrix with the corresponding column variances along the diagonal c is normalized by the number of observations1. To use pdf, specify the probability distribution name and its parameters. This matlab function returns the mean of the elements of a along the first array. If a is a vector of observations, c is the scalarvalued variance. This matlab function returns the standard deviation of the elements of a. Multivariate analysis of variance matlab mathworks espana. Analysis of covariance is a technique for analyzing grouped data having a response y, the variable to be predicted and a predictor x, the variable used to do the prediction. The variance is normalized by the number of observations1. To examine the dimensions of a table, use the height, width, or size functions. The following matlab project contains the source code and matlab examples used for resistor calculator. Specify optional commaseparated pairs of name,value arguments.
The variance is normalized by the number of observations1 by default. Routhhurwitz stability criterion in matlab youtube. If a is a vector of observations, then the standard deviation is a scalar if a is a matrix whose columns are random variables and whose rows are observations, then s is a row vector containing the standard deviations corresponding to each column if a is a multidimensional array, then stda operates along the first array dimension whose size does not equal 1, treating the elements as vectors. This project is designed to give you a brief introduction to the matlab software which will be used to help carry out your computer projects during this semester. Analysis of covariance introduction to analysis of covariance. For single matrix input, c has size sizea,2 sizea,2 based on the number of random variables columns represented by a.
This software is especially designed for mathematical, scientific and engineering applications. This site is a part of the javascript elabs learning objects for decision making. The second input, k, cannot have type int64 or uint64. If a is a vector, then mediana returns the median value of a if a is a nonempty matrix, then mediana treats the columns of a as vectors and returns a row vector of median values if a is an empty 0by0 matrix, mediana returns nan if a is a multidimensional array, then mediana treats the values along the first array dimension whose size does not equal 1 as vectors. When the first input, x, is a scalar, nchoosek returns a binomial coefficient. Use nway anova to determine if the means in a set of data differ with respect to groups levels of multiple factors. I made the window of the calculator but now i do not know how to take the inserted values and display the result in the textfield which i call result. Average or mean value of array matlab mean mathworks italia. Chisquare probability density function matlab chi2pdf. Desviacion estandar matlab std mathworks america latina. If a is a matrix whose columns represent random variables and whose rows represent observations, c is the covariance matrix with the corresponding column variances along the diagonal. This process is experimental and the keywords may be updated as the learning algorithm improves. This site will look best in a browser that supports web standards, but it is accessible to any browser or internet device. The functions rowfun and varfun each apply a specified function to a table, yet many other functions require numeric or homogeneous arrays as input arguments.
We shall start with scalar operations, for which matlab acts like a very powerful calculator. Crs 603 introduction matlab matrix laboratory is a software package designed for efficient, reliable numerical computing. For the same reason never use variable names cell, length, size, i, j, table, etc. Nonparametric methods statistics and machine learning toolbox functions include nonparametric versions of oneway and twoway analysis of variance. If a is a matrix whose columns are random variables and whose rows are observations, v is a row vector containing the variances corresponding to each column. The following matlab project contains the source code and matlab examples used for simple calculator. At the click of a button, for example, funtool draws a graph representing the sum, product, difference, or ratio of two functions that you specify.
The size of this dimension becomes 1 while the sizes of all other dimensions remain the same. S stda,w,vecdim computes the standard deviation over the dimensions specified in the vector vecdim when w is 0 or 1. Many of you probably have already used a scientific or graphics calculator like the ti84. The funtool app is a visual function calculator that manipulates and displays functions of one variable. If a is a vector of observations, the variance is a scalar. The variances of the columns are along the diagonal. For an example of anova with random effects, see anova with random. Beginners make the mistake of reassigning name of important functions, and are then surprised when the inbuilt function does not work. By default, anovan treats all grouping variables as fixed effects. If a is a multidimensional array, then vara treats the values along the first array dimension whose size does not equal 1 as vectors.
As the name matlab matrix laboratory suggests, most of the commands work with matrices and these will be discussed in due course. Length of largest array dimension matlab length mathworks. These keywords were added by machine and not by the authors. You can use the statistics and machine learning toolbox function anovan to perform nway anova. Matlab is a highlevel language and interactive environment that enables you to perform computationally intensive tasks faster than with traditional programming languages such. When the first input, x, is a vector, nchoosek treats it as a set.
413 289 1283 895 28 1144 598 716 910 114 79 1228 1310 569 683 208 697 187 149 1412 1102 467 40 944 246 778 469 132 1093 788 257 1439 639 28 306 609 114 309